Lincoln Square fun facts...


Lincoln Square, encompasses the Ravenswood, Ravenswood Gardens, Bowmanville and Budlong Woods neighborhoods, as well as Lincoln Square itself.


In the 1840s, newly arriving German Americans started farming in the area. Two brothers, Lyman and Joseph Budlong arrived in 1857 and started a commercial pickling operation. They later opened a commercial green house and flower fields to provide flowers for the new Rosehill Cemetery. In 1925, to honor Abraham Lincoln, the Chicago City Council named the area Lincoln Square, and a prominent statue of Lincoln was erected in 1956.


About 44,000 people live in the neighborhood along with over 1,000 small and medium-sized businesses. Its housing stock consists of private residences and small apartment buildings.


The commercial heart of Lincoln Square is located at the intersection of Lawrence, Western and Lincoln Avenues. Lincoln Avenue southeast of this intersection is home to a wide variety of restaurants and shops. Lincoln Square is historically known as a heavily German influenced neighborhood, but now you will also find shops catering to the Thai culture. Still, the neighborhood is home to a number of German businesses, including Merz Apothecary and Lutz Café & Bakery, and is the home of the Chicago branches of DANK (the German American National Congress) and the Niedersachsen Club. The German-language weekly newspaper Amerika Woche [de] was started in Lincoln Square in 1972, though its original headquarters above the Brauhaus is now only a bureau.


Events such as festivals and live musical performances are frequently held in Lincoln Square. The Apple Fest is a longstanding tradition in Lincoln Square that brings the community together to celebrate the beginning of fall. Dozens of vendors participate each year selling autumn-themed crafts and apple-themed treats, such as fresh baked apple pies, bushels of apples and hot apple cider. The Square Roots Festival, held every summer, celebrates Lincoln Square's history in music and German culture with live performances from local musicians and craft beer from local breweries.

Lincoln Square neighborhood, Chicago, Masonry Maintenance

All buildings require maintenance. Masonry buildings may seem to be maintenance free because they last for hundreds of years. But make no mistake, to remain issue-free, safe and dry, masonry buildings need maintenance. Every 30 years or so, historic masonry buildings need to have the mortar ground out of the mortar joints and re-pointed with lime mortar. Masonry buildings built after 1950 need maintenance every 20 years or so, depending on the craftsmanship. But masonry buildings built since 1990 need specialized services to mitigate water and moisture intrusion. Buildings built with split face block and other modern masonry products like "jumbo brick" which is brick-colored concrete and "Renaissance Stone" which is pre-cast concrete need maintenance more often than buildings constructed with common brick or buildings with a brick facade and block structural wall. Lincoln Square neighborhood – Masonry Sealant Applications

Not all masonry buildings require sealant, but if you own a building built after 1990, chances are at least one wall is constructed with modern materials like split face block or jumbo block, the parapet walls may have be finished with capstones that look like limestone, but are actually Renaissance Stone or pre-cast concrete or there are decorative details on the building that look like limestone, but are actually Renaissance Stone or pre-cast concrete. All of these modern materials are highly porous and prone to absorbing rain water which moves through these materials and into your building. Lincoln Square neighborhood, Chicago, IL Split Face Block Repair

Many masonry buildings built in the Lincoln Square neighborhood since 1990 are wet. These wet buildings need specialized services to mitigate water and moisture intrusion. Buildings built with split face block and other modern masonry products like "jumbo brick" which is brick-colored concrete and "Renaissance Stone" which is pre-cast concrete need ventilation to release moisture trapped in the building's walls and roof system. We recommend installing WickRight passive ventilation on buildings built with split face block, concrete block, jumbo block and Renaissance Stone or precast concrete. Buildings built with split face block, concrete block, jumbo block also need to be sealed with masonry sealant. Renaissance stone and pre-cast concrete are difficult to seal, so we suggest covering these details with sheet metal or designing custom flashings to divert water and rain away from these materials.
